fluent17.0的udf和visual studio 2015的環境變量問題? 200
請問各位大神,在fluent17.0中編譯udf,下面是build和load出現的問題:
Opening library "C:\Users\Administrator\Desktop\HXT2D\sanbufen\libudf"...
Error: The UDF library you are trying to load (libudf) is not compiled for 2d on the current platform (win64).
?μí3?ò2?μ????¨μ????t?£
C:\Users\Administrator\Desktop\HXT2D\sanbufen\libudf\win64\2d\libudf.dll
Error: The UDF library you are trying to load (libudf) is not compiled for 2d on the current platform (win64).\n\n?μí3?ò2?μ????¨μ????t?£
\n\nC:\Users\Administrator\Desktop\HXT2D\sanbufen\libudf\win64\2d\libudf.dll
Error Object: #f
然后在網上說要改fluent里面的udf.bat,我的visual studio安裝在D:\microsft visual studio2015里面,下面是我改動后的udf.bat:
set MSVC_DEFAULT=D:\microsft visual studio2015\microsft visual studio2015
if exist "%MSVC_DEFAULT%\VC\vcvarsall.bat" set MSVC=%MSVC_DEFAULT%
if not "%MSVC%" == "" goto msvc_env140
echo trying to find MS C compiler, version 120....
然后也改了系統的環境變量:
include
D:\microsft visual studio2015\VC\include
lib
D:\microsft visual studio2015\VC\lib
path
D:\microsft visual studio2015\Common7\IDE;D:\microsft visual studio2015\VC\bin
用戶變量改得是和系統的變量一樣的。
弄了好幾天了,麻煩各位大神能指出我的問題所在,謝謝啦!




















